Make the Awesome Sauce:
Whisk all sauce ingredients in a bowl until smooth. Taste and adjust seasoning. Cover and refrigerate until ready to use.
Shape the Patties:
Divide the beef into 4 equal portions. Gently shape into patties without overmixing.
Sprinkle each side with salt and pepper. Grill or sear in a hot skillet over medium-high heat for 4–5 minutes per side. Add cheese during the last minute so it melts over the top.
Toast the Buns:
Optional—but highly recommended. Toast cut sides of buns on the grill or in a skillet until golden.
Assemble the Burgers:
Spread awesome sauce on the bottom bun. Add patty, lettuce, pickles, onion, more sauce, and the top bun. Serve hot.
Yes, you need the fat. That 80/20 ground beef ratio is where the juiciness lives. Lean meat just won’t give you the same result.
About the awesome sauce: it’s a little sweet, a little tangy, and ridiculously addictive. Want it spicier? Swap in Sriracha or hot sauce instead of ketchup.
Pro tip on buns: Toasting them makes a huge difference. The crispy edges + juicy burger = everything.
